Recipe - No-Knead Rolls

Categories: None, No-Knead Rolls
Ingredients:

2 cup Allpurpose flour
1 pack Active dry yeast
1 One fourth cup Milk
One half cup Butter
One fourth cup Sugar
1 teaspoon Salt
1 Egg
1 One fourth cup All purpose whole wheat
flour

In large mixing bowl, mix the 2 cups flour and yeast with a wooden spoon.
In saucepan, combine milk, butter, sugar and salt; cook over medium heat,
stirring frequently, until butter almost melts and mixture is warm (115
degrees). Pour warm mixture over flour mixture. Add egg and beat at low
speed with electric mixer for 30 seconds; beat at high speed for 3 minutes.
Gradually stir in the 1 One fourth cups whole wheat flour (or allpurpose as a
substitute); beat with wooden spoon till smooth. Cover dough in bowl with
greased waxed paper. Put bowl in a warm place to rise for 1 hour or till
dough is doubled. Beat dough with a wooden spoon. Let rest 5 minutes.
Grease 20 muffin cups with shortening. Drop batter, with a spoon, into
muffin pans, filling them about One half way. Cover with greased waxed paper and
let rise in warm place 30 minutes or till doubled. Remove waxed paper. Bake
in a 400 degree oven for 1215 minutes or until golden. Cool in pan 5
minutes. Remove and cool on rack or serve. Makes 20 rolls. Recipe from 1981
